## 3.7.2 — Key rotation for Threadline tracing

Heads up: we rotated the signing key used by the Threadline request-tracing collector after the old one hit its expiry window. All microservices that forward spans through the Brindlehop gateway will need the updated trust bundle before the next deploy, or trace ingestion silently drops to zero (ask Joss how we know). Nothing else changed in this patch — same sampling rates, same span schema. Update your pipeline config with the new key, shown here.

release key, fajef-kajeg: bky19_LdLu6Ne6FLi8he2c24d

Ticket: Staging env misconfigured for Siftgate bloom filter

The bloom layer in front of the Pellet KV store is rejecting all lookups in staging because the env file was copied from the dev template without credentials. False-positive tuning values are fine; only the auth line is missing. To unblock the weekly demo, the Pellet admission secret must be set on the following line.

env line for yaguf-fajop: LEDGER_TOKEN13=fb08984397349

The garage occupancy feed for the Brindlewood campus arrives over a message queue every thirty seconds, one record per level, published by the Stallgrid edge boxes. Counts can briefly go negative when a sensor double-fires on exit; the ingest job clamps these to zero and flags the interval. If the feed stalls for more than five minutes, the dashboard falls back to the last known snapshot. Sensor mappings, queue names, and the replay procedure are documented on the internal page below.

runbook for tahog-kadug: https://gitlab.qirvanworks.corp/projects/pages/view/b139298aed28